Hollywood productions first appeared on many private websites before they leaked to the public trackers Pirate Bay and KickassTorrents, where thousands of users began downloading the unexpected Christmas gift.
The first leaks occurred a week ago and the FBI is trying to spot the source of leakage from the watermarks in the movies.
The Hollywood Reporter now reports that the watermark on Tarantino's The Hateful Eight leads to Andrew Kosove, co-CEO oftreatments, and financing of the company Alcon Entertainment.
The screener intended for Kosove is reportedly never reached.
"I have never seen this DVD. I never touched it with my hands. We will do more than work with the FBI. "We will conduct our own investigation to find out what happened," Kosove told the Hollywood Reporter.
Meanwhile Hollywood began issuing thousands requests removal, in the hope that this will prevent the movies from being downloaded.
But who are The Hive and CM8?
Hive-CM8 is a so-called "release group" but does not belong to the scene (The Scene). According to TorrentFreak, very few people are involved, but they managed to ruin the Christmas of a multi-billion dollar industry.
The Hive-CM8 team has released 11 DVD screeners so far, with the latest Specter. However, in .nfo they say there are 40 titles in total, which means we will see something new every day.
So far the leaked screeners are: Spectre, The Hateful Eight, Legend, In The Heart of The Sea, Joy, Steve Jobs, Spotlight, Creed, Concussion, The Danish Girl, Bridge of Spies.
